Description

3-Hydroxy-Propionimidic Acid Ethyl Ester is a versatile organic intermediate with a reactive imidic ester and hydroxyl functional group. This unique bifunctional structure makes it a valuable building block for synthesizing heterocyclic compounds and fine chemicals. It is primarily sought after by research and development chemists and process engineers in the pharmaceutical and agrochemical industries.

Application

  • Pharmaceutical Intermediate: Key precursor in the synthesis of active pharmaceutical ingredients (APIs), particularly those containing nitrogen heterocycles like imidazoles and pyrimidines.
  • Agrochemical Synthesis: Used in the production of herbicides, fungicides, and plant growth regulators, leveraging its reactivity to form complex molecular scaffolds.
  • Ligand and Chelating Agent Precursor: Serves as a starting material for creating specialized ligands used in catalysis and metal complexation.
  • Polymer Modification: Employed to introduce functional imidate or hydroxyl groups into polymer chains for specialty materials.
  • Organic Synthesis Building Block: Utilized in multi-step synthetic routes for constructing complex organic molecules in academic and industrial research.
  • Cross-linking Agent: Potential use in the formulation of resins and coatings due to its reactive ester group.

Basic Information

Product Name 3-Hydroxy-Propionimidic Acid Ethyl Ester
CAS No. 20914-87-8
Molecular Formula C5H9NO2
Molecular Weight 115.13 g/mol
Synonyms Ethyl 3-Hydroxypropionimidate; 3-Hydroxypropionimidic Acid Ethyl Ester; Ethyl 3-Hydroxyimidopropionate; β-Hydroxypropionimidic Acid Ethyl Ester; NSC 163044; 3-Hydroxypropanoimidic Acid Ethyl Ester; Ethyl β-Hydroxypropionimidate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). This material is hygroscopic (moisture-sensitive); keep the container tightly sealed to minimize exposure to atmospheric moisture.
